Transaction 11523c19ecc00f95a9b1918c233ae9867cb9f16f138011e8568b129cb56cc35e

1 Input
2 Outputs
  • 11523c19ecc00f95a9b1918c233ae9867cb9f16f138011e8568b129cb56cc35e:0
  • value  134790
    address  1EU5W6eZhcYAxVHcysA53ruFiMGgC4RPY3
  • 11523c19ecc00f95a9b1918c233ae9867cb9f16f138011e8568b129cb56cc35e:1
  • value  1946
    address  bc1qy2k52hh7ezhj5sg0ur7uulxs0sgtn3fnld23ye